def controls_setup(self): """DatePicker controls""" self.date_box = element.InputElement(self, alias="Date Box", css_selector='input.date', angular=True) self.set_today = element.Button(self, alias="Set Today Button", css_selector='button.today', button_type='button', angular=True) self.clear = element.Button(self, alias="Clear Button", css_selector='button.clear', button_type='button', angular=True)
def form_setup(self): super(AdminListPage, self).form_setup() self.error = element.Caption(self, css_selector='p.alert.alert-error', alias="Error Message", angular=True) self.success = element.Caption(self, css_selector='.alert.alert-success', alias="Success Message", angular=True) self.keyword = element.InputElement(self, dom_id='searchbar', alias="Keyword") self.active_status = element.DropDown(self, name='active_start_date', alias="Active Status Dropdown") self.active_start_date = element.DropDown(self, name='active_start_date__gte', alias="Active Start Date Dropdown") self.active_end_date = element.DropDown(self, name='active_end_date__gte', alias="Active End Date Dropdown") self.search = element.Button(self, css_selector='input.submit', alias="Seatch Button") self.top_nav_menu = container.AdminDashboardNavMenu(self) self.left_sidebar = container.AdminDashboardLeftSidebar(self) self.footer = container.AdminDashboardFooter(self) self.add = element.LinkButton(self, css_selector='.object-tools > a', alias="Add Item Button")
def controls_setup(self): """OcomInputCheckBox controls""" super(OcomInputCheckBox, self).controls_setup() self.check_box = element.InputElement(self, alias="CheckBox Entry", css_selector='input', angular=True) self.symbol = element.Caption(self, alias="CheckBox Symbol", css_selector='.ocom-checkbox', angular=True)
def controls_setup(self): """OcomInputSelectBox controls""" super(OcomInputSelectBox, self).controls_setup() self.select = element.InputElement(self, alias="SelectBox Entry", css_selector='select', angular=True)
def controls_setup(self): """OcomInputNumberBox controls""" super(OcomInputNumberBox, self).controls_setup() self.number_box = element.InputElement(self, alias="NumberBox Entry", css_selector='input', angular=True)
def controls_setup(self): """OcomInputTextArea controls""" super(OcomInputTextArea, self).controls_setup() self.text_box = element.InputElement(self, alias="TextArea Entry", css_selector='textarea', angular=True)
def controls_setup(self): """DateTimePicker controls""" super(DateTimePicker, self).controls_setup() self.time_box = element.InputElement(self, alias="Time Box", css_selector='input.time', angular=True)